From 15234e1e09b01402f2e1477374b49acf2a7c8f16 Mon Sep 17 00:00:00 2001
From: Administrator <15274802129@163.com>
Date: Tue, 21 Apr 2026 17:55:43 +0800
Subject: [PATCH] fix(ai): 排序从升序改为降序

---
 src/main/java/cc/mrbird/febs/ai/service/impl/AiAgentServiceImpl.java |    7 ++++++-
 1 files changed, 6 insertions(+), 1 deletions(-)

diff --git a/src/main/java/cc/mrbird/febs/ai/service/impl/AiAgentServiceImpl.java b/src/main/java/cc/mrbird/febs/ai/service/impl/AiAgentServiceImpl.java
index 532f828..a722957 100644
--- a/src/main/java/cc/mrbird/febs/ai/service/impl/AiAgentServiceImpl.java
+++ b/src/main/java/cc/mrbird/febs/ai/service/impl/AiAgentServiceImpl.java
@@ -59,7 +59,8 @@
         }
         query.eq(AiAgentCategory::getCompanyId, dto.getCompanyId());
         query.eq(AiAgentCategory::getState, 1);
-        query.orderByAsc(AiAgentCategory::getSort);
+//        query.orderByAsc(AiAgentCategory::getSort);
+        query.orderByDesc(AiAgentCategory::getSort);
         List<AiAgentCategory> listByQuery = aiAgentCategoryMapper.selectList(query);
         if (CollUtil.isNotEmpty(listByQuery)){
             for (AiAgentCategory entity : listByQuery){
@@ -76,6 +77,10 @@
     @Override
     public FebsResponse agentList(ApiAgentPageDto dto) {
         // 创建分页对象,传入当前页和每页大小
+
+        if (StrUtil.isEmpty(dto.getCompanyId())){
+            dto.setCompanyId(AiCommonEnum.COMPANY_ID.getPrompt());
+        }
         Page<ApiAgentVo> page = new Page<>(dto.getPageNow(), dto.getPageSize());
         Page<ApiAgentVo> pageListByQuery = aiAgentMapper.getPageListByQuery(page, dto);
         return new FebsResponse().success().data(pageListByQuery);

--
Gitblit v1.9.1